James Cameron’s latest installment, Avatar: Fire and Ash, experienced a notable decrease in global box office momentum as it entered its first Monday, once again relying heavily on overseas markets for overall support. This third chapter in the acclaimed franchise premiered over the weekend but displayed an early and surprising slump.
The film kicked off with a formidable $88 million in North America and garnered an impressive $347 million globally in its initial three days. However, revenues took a significant hit on Day 4, with Monday’s domestic earnings dropping to $13 million—a steep 45% decline from the previous day—pushing North American totals slightly above the $100 million mark.
International contributions provided only tepid backing. On Monday, the film generated an additional $39 million from global markets, raising its international total to $296 million. By the conclusion of its fourth day in theaters, Avatar: Fire and Ash had amassed $398.7 million at the box office worldwide.
Although the film currently holds the title of the third-largest opening of this year, following Zootopia 2 and Wicked: For Good, its overall performance lags behind earlier benchmarks for the franchise. Avatar: The Way of Water achieved over $500 million globally in the same timeframe, leaving Fire and Ash trailing by over 25%.
Despite the early drop-off, the Avatar franchise is renowned for its lengthy theatrical runs, often buoyed by robust word-of-mouth. Industry experts are keenly observing how Fire and Ash may recover and gain momentum in the upcoming days.
Featuring Zoe Saldana and Sam Worthington as devoted parents striving to protect their family and Pandora, Avatar: Fire and Ash also introduces Oona Chaplin as a new foe. The esteemed Avatar series remains a powerhouse in cinema, with future sequels expected in 2029 and 2031.
